Honey Almond Cake

Ingredients

Scale
  • ⅔ cup all-purpose flour
  • 1 teaspoon baking powder
  • ¼ teaspoon kosher salt
  • ¾ cup unsalted butter (room temperature)
  • 1 cup granulated sugar
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la paste or extract
  • 1 teaspoon almond extract
  • 3 large eggs (room temperature and whisked)
  • 1 cup finely ground almond flour
  • ⅓ cup sliced almonds
  • ⅓ cup honey
  • ⅓ cup water


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 375℉ and grease an 8-inch cake pan lined with parchment paper.
  2. In a small bowl, whisk together all-purpose flour, baking powder, and salt.
  3. In a stand mixer or using a hand mixer, cream unsalted butter and granulated sugar on medium speed until fluffy (about 2 minutes).
  4. Add vanilla and almond extracts followed by whisked eggs, mixing until incorporated.
  5. Gradually incorporate dry ingredients until nearly combined; then fold in almond flour by hand.
  6. Transfer batter to the prepared pan and sprinkle sliced almonds on top.
  7. Bake for 28-35 minutes until edges pull away from the pan and a toothpick comes out with moist crumbs.
  8. While baking, prepare honey simple syrup by heating honey and water in a saucepan until combined.
  9. Once baked, pour syrup over warm cake and let cool for 20 minutes before removing from the pan.
